Output d1e668113e56a2a44220ace48e17cef876a366321a6b78fc2174327dee69f01d:4

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8bfec7b58c5a51a23499cdf2eb7a7e726171b11 OP_EQUAL
address
3MT5o5LQDtdTm4aJYpsfdjbGuszdWRrVBE
transaction
d1e668113e56a2a44220ace48e17cef876a366321a6b78fc2174327dee69f01d
spent
true